Expected Duration: 1 year or more 3-5 Years’ experience Static Structural Analysis (Required) Employ Classical (Hand) Analysis Techniques Develop Free Body Diagrams Determine Interface Loads Material and Fastener Stress and Margin of Safety Calculations Prepare Stress Reports Review of 2D & 3D CAD Data, Associated BOMs and Vendor Specifications (Required) Catia V5 (Preferred) Experience with Sheet Metal and Honeycomb Structures and Assembly Processes (Preferred) Aircraft Cabin Interiors Engineering Experience (Required) FEMAP Experience (Required) Stress Analyst/Certification Engineering position in the Certification Group. Responsibilities involve performing stress analysis and related activities for new and derivative designs of interior furnishings and amenities as part of outfitting new aircraft, along with supporting other Certification related activities. This includes review of Engineering drawings, preparing load calculations and writing stress reports in collaboration with the Structural Engineering group and Structural AR's providing approvals. Example designs include custom cabinetry such as galleys, lavatories, closets and other storage compartments, interior peripheries, water/waste systems, entertainment equipment installations, seating installations. Analysis of installation design is also involved, along with necessary airframe modifications to meet requirements of the interior installation. Candidates should be proficient with finite elements analysis and have a sufficient knowledge of AutoCAD and/or CATIA V5 CAD tools to adequately review Engineering designs. Assignments are executed under the direction of the Engineering Group Head to meet the Engineering, Certification and manufacturing schedules. Analysis methods and design standards to be employed are consistent with company standards and accepted methods. Additional responsibilities are out lined in the job description and as assigned by the Certification Engineering Group Head. Review of new Engineering data in the off board process and preparation of structural substantiation as appropriate. This activity needs to support the Engineering release schedule, so time constraints are involved. Preparation of a Structural Substantiation Report for each Completion aircraft as assigned. Accomplishing aircraft level Finite Element Modeling and Processing (FEMAP) and other forms of analysis such as decompression analysis, grouping analysis, etc. Attending up front meetings and review of the design packages to highlight and resolve any potential issues in the proposed design that relate to structural substantiation. Participation in cross site standardization efforts and helping to resolve differences while preventing new ones Working together with the structural engineers and structures ODA Engineering Authorized Representatives (EAR's) to support the project deliverables and schedule for Engineering and Certification activities.
